GENERAL DESCRIPTION:
The California Maritime Academy, a specialized campus of the California State University (CSU) system serves a student population of approximately 850 and a faculty of about 100 full and part-time members. The campus, situated on the shore of the Carquinez Strait close to San Francisco currently offers baccalaureate programs in five disciplines and includes licensing programs for future merchant marines, coast guard and naval reserve officers. There are plans for enrollment growth and curricular expansion including an online international master’s program.
